In Ukraine, live pork prices continue to grow
The Ukrainian association estimates that most domestic producers will increase their prices by 1-2.5 UAH (0.03-0.08 euros) per kilogram, making the pork prices surpass 50 UAH (1.63 euros) per kilogram.
The increase in prices is caused by a shortage in pork supply and the high demand for animals which have not reached the standard slaughter weight, and the outbreaks of African Swine Fever (ASF).
